Output 883623028dcdc4e0f3f011ca209a9fc4a689b15156bfe36ed5aebc5373006184:40
- value
- 450272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 106586fc5ebce04399ed5b5a1cd0c484eab7dca6 OP_EQUAL
- address
- 33BiMrQke3T9CuFpX3AgEjPtVdZpHbvH9D
- transaction
- 883623028dcdc4e0f3f011ca209a9fc4a689b15156bfe36ed5aebc5373006184
- confirmations
- 270791
- spent
- true